Holtwood is a small, close-knit community of around 2,250 residents, with a median age of 42 and a nearly even gender balance. The area is predominantly White, with a modest percentage of non-English speakers, making it a friendly and welcoming environment for families and newcomers.

What is the average cost of living in Holtwood, PA?
Holtwood offers a cost of living slightly below the national average, highlighted by affordable median home values at $285,000 and typical rents around $1,250. Utilities and groceries are reasonably priced, and state income tax remains low at 3.07%, making the area attractive for budget-conscious households.

Is Holtwood, PA a safe place to live?
Holtwood enjoys a notably low crime rate, with only 78 violent crimes per 100,000 residents and a 1 in 1,282 chance of being affected, providing peace of mind for families. Property crime is also lower than many urban areas, supporting a safe, community-focused lifestyle.

What is the weather like in Holtwood, PA year-round?
Residents experience all four seasons, with warm summers reaching up to 86°F and chilly winters dropping to 24°F. The area receives about 44 inches of rainfall annually and enjoys sunshine roughly 52% of the year, offering a balanced climate for outdoor activities.

How are the schools in Holtwood, PA?
Holtwood is home to reputable public schools such as Marticville Middle and Penn Manor High, both known for favorable student-teacher ratios. The area also offers private education options and is close to Millersville University, providing diverse educational opportunities from K–12 through college.

What is the housing market like in Holtwood, PA?
With a median home price of $285,000 and over 82% of homes owner-occupied, Holtwood offers a stable and affordable housing market. Home values have appreciated by 4.2% in the past year and rental vacancy is low, making it a great place for both buyers and renters.
